On Wednesday 04 February 2009 08:57:40 Anne Wilson wrote: > The settings you mention were set > to ascii-us. I've now changed that to utf-8. Hopefully that will quieten > it. As far as I understand, that shouldn't be a problem either, I mean, having the ascii-us as long as you have utf-8 on the list. "This list is checked for every outgoing message from the top to the bottom for a charset that contains all required characters" I understand that kmail automatically selects the charset that best covers all the characters. I also have checked the option to keep the original charset when replying or forwading if possible. With these settings I hardly get any problem at all with charsets!
